How to make Hash Browns

Introduction 

Hash browns are a delicious breakfast food that is enjoyed by people all over the world. They are made by shredding or grating potatoes, then cooking them until they are crispy and golden brown. Hash browns can be served on their own as a side dish, or they can be added to breakfast sandwiches, burritos, or other breakfast foods.



History of Hash Browns:

The origins of hash browns are not clear, but they are believed to have been popularized in the United States in the early 20th century. Hash browns were originally a way for people to use up leftover potatoes from the previous day's meal. They were an inexpensive and easy way to create a tasty breakfast dish that could feed a family. Over time, hash browns became more popular and were eventually served in restaurants and diners across the country.

How to Make Hash Browns:

Hash Browns are a delicious and simple breakfast dish that can be made with just a few ingredients. Here is a basic recipe for making Hash Browns:

Ingredients:

  • 2-3 medium-sized potatoes, peeled and grated
  • 1 small onion, grated
  • 1 egg
  • 1/4 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 tsp salt
  • 1/4 tsp black pepper
  • 2-3 tbsp vegetable oil


Instructions:

  • Grate the peeled potatoes and onion using a box grater or a food processor. Squeeze out any excess liquid from the grated mixture and transfer it to a large mixing bowl.
  • Add the egg, all-purpose flour, salt, and black pepper to the mixing bowl and mix everything together well.
  • Heat 2-3 tablespoons of vegetable oil in a large non-stick skillet over medium heat.
  • Once the oil is hot, take a handful of the potato mixture and form it into a patty. The patty should be about 1/4 inch thick.
  • Carefully place the patty into the hot oil and repeat with the remaining potato mixture. You should be able to fit 2-3 patties in the skillet at a time.
  • Cook the Hash Browns for about 3-4 minutes on each side, or until they are golden brown and crispy.
  • Once the Hash Browns are cooked, transfer them to a paper towel-lined plate to drain off any excess oil.
  • Serve the Hash Browns hot with your favorite breakfast sides such as eggs, bacon, or sausage.

Making hash browns is relatively easy and requires just a few simple ingredients. To start, you will need to peel and grate your potatoes. You can use any type of potato you like, but russet potatoes are typically the best for making hash browns because they are starchy and hold their shape well during cooking.

Once you have grated your potatoes, you will need to squeeze out as much excess water as possible. This can be done by placing the grated potatoes in a clean kitchen towel and squeezing out the water over a sink or bowl.

Next, you will need to heat some oil in a skillet over medium-high heat. Once the oil is hot, add your grated potatoes to the skillet and spread them out in an even layer. Let the potatoes cook for several minutes without stirring until they are crispy and golden brown on one side. Then, use a spatula to flip the potatoes over and cook the other side until it is crispy and golden brown as well.

Season your hash browns with salt, pepper, and any other seasonings you like. Some people like to add diced onions or bell peppers to their hash browns for extra flavor.



Variations of Hash Browns:

There are many variations of hash browns that you can try, depending on your taste preferences. One popular variation is to add cheese to the hash browns as they cook, creating a delicious cheesy crust. Another variation is to add cooked bacon, ham, or sausage to the hash browns for a heartier breakfast dish. Some people even like to add leftover vegetables, such as broccoli or cauliflower, to their hash browns for a healthier twist.
